Description

Sometimes we may find ourself mentally stuck in the past, feeling bogged down by regrets, resentments or negative self-concepts. Buddhist teachings offer many gentle and practical methods that help us to heal our mind and move into a more peaceful, empowered and confident state. In this workshop we will explore some of these teachings and how to apply them practically in our daily life.

About the Teacher

Gen Kelsang Tashi is a Buddhist monk and the Resident Teacher of Kadampa Meditation Center Miami. He has been practicing and teaching meditation in the Kadampa tradition for over 15 years. His gentle approach to meditation emphasizes the importance of keeping a happy and positive mind. He is appreciated for his clear, light-hearted and practical presentation of Buddhist teachings.
